Verdict

LAVASPIN gained his fourth track victory with a comfortable all-the-way success in November. He was competing in Carnival races last year which will be his aim again so should be up to winning this despite a 6lb rise. Vale Of Kent won eight races for Mark Johnston including three on the all-weather while Behavioral Bias made a fine reappearance in a Listed contest last month. Rio Angie dropped down a couple of levels to make all for a very easy victory in November but will find this much tougher while Madkhal also takes a step-up in class after a comfortable victory over 7f with Moqarrab 6 lengths behind. Dark Silver had 17 races in the UK without winning but made a spectacular debut for new connections at Jebel Ali, scoring by almost ten lengths.
